    Easy measurement worksheets tailored specifically for ages 4-5 play a crucial role in laying the foundation for a child's understanding of basic mathematical and scientific concepts. At this tender age, children are naturally curious and eager to explore the world around them. Introducing them to easy measurement activities helps satisfy their inquisitive minds while making learning a fun and engaging experience.

    These worksheets are designed with young learners in mind, ensuring that the tasks are not only age-appropriate but also visually appealing. Through a variety of hands-on activities, children learn to compare lengths, weights, and volumes, often using everyday objects familiar to them. This approach allows them to grasp complex ideas in a simple and relatable manner.

    Moreover, easy measurement worksheets for ages 4-5 help in developing critical thinking and problem-solving skills early on. As they measure and compare objects, children learn to make observations, identify patterns, and draw conclusions. These skills are invaluable not only in their immediate learning environment but also as they progress through their educational journey.

    In essence, these worksheets offer a gentle introduction to the world of measurement, paving the way for a deeper understanding and appreciation of mathematics and science. They are an indispensable tool in nurturing young minds, encouraging exploration, and building confidence in their abilities to learn and grow.
